Vietnamese Nearshore Wind Farm Nears Commissioning

UK-based marine consultant Waves Group Ltd (Waves Group) has completed Marine Warranty Surveyor (MWS) services for the construction of the Hiep Thanh nearshore wind farm in Vietnam, helping bring the project closer to the commissioning.

The company’s scope of work included the installation of foundations, wind turbines, array cables, and nearshore marine works.

With the nearshore construction complete, the project is scheduled to be commissioned in the first quarter of the year, Waves Group said.

The 78 MW Hiep Thanh nearshore wind farm is located between one and three kilometres off the coast of Tra Vinh Province.

The wind farm will feature 18 Siemens Gamesa 4.3 MW wind turbines that are set to produce 295.4 GWh/year of renewable energy, providing up to 180,975 households with clean energy.

Last year, Guangzhou Salvage Bureau installed all monopile foundations at the nearshore sites of the Hiep Thanh and Tra Vinh V1-2 wind farms in Vietnam.

The project is being developed by EcoTech Tra Vinh Renewables JSC, and its investors, Janakuasa Pte Ltd, Ecotech Vietnam, Climate Investor One, which is managed by Climate Fund Managers (CFM), and ST International.

In 2020, Waves Group secured a contract to provide MWS services for the Tra Vinh nearshore wind farm in Vietnam.
